Fluorescent pigment

Fluorescent pigments are a kind of pigments, such as some kinds of vitamins (a, B2), biological pigments, lipids, elastic fibers, etc The color effect and imaging effect of spontaneous fluorescence under microscope are very weak, and the imaging time is also short. Some chemical components in organisms spontaneously excite fluorescence under the irradiation of short wave spectral lines, which is called primaryfluorescence. For example, some kinds of vitamins (a, B2), biological pigments, lipids, elastic fibers, etc The color effect and imaging effect of spontaneous fluorescence under microscope are very weak, and the imaging time is also short. Biological samples treated with fluorescent pigments can stimulate brilliant fluorescence under the irradiation of short wave spectral lines, which is called secondary fluorescence. The color development effect and imaging effect of secondary fluorescence are extremely strong. Therefore, it occupies an important position in fluorescence microscope technology. Nowadays, the synthesis of more effective fluorescent pigments, the development of more specific labeling technology, the variable relationship between fluorescent pigments and excitation light wavelength, the quantitative determination of fluorescence intensity and the fluorescence scanning classification of chromosome dyeing are all major exploration directions.

Fluorescent pigments can be broadly divided into three categories:

1. Alkaline fluorescent pigments are easily dissociated in acidic solutions. Its fluorescent component has a positive charge. Therefore, it can bind ions with acidic groups in biological samples. It is in a non dissociative state in alkaline solution.

2. Acidic fluorescent pigments are easy to dissociate in alkaline solution, and their fluorescent components are negatively charged.

3. Neutral fluorescent pigment weak acid or weak alkali fluorescent pigment is electrically neutral pigment Its dissociation has no practical significance in the process of fluorescent staining. This pigment is mostly used to show the structure of macromolecules.

The field of using fluorescein is particularly broad. For example, the identification of impurities in mineral oil in mineralogy, the classification of quartz sand in optical glass industry, the identification of reservoir leakage in hydrogeology, the detection of blood stains and fine spots in forensic medicine, the inspection of metal cracks in mechanical industry, the identification of classical works of art and fakes, bacteriology, virology, immunology, oncology, genetics, fiber textile industry and various other majors can apply fluorescence technology.
